Restaurant or Restaraunt – Which is Correct?
One of the most frequently misspelled words in the English language is “restaurant.” It’s a word that seems to throw off many native speakers and non-native speakers alike. How should it be spelled? Is it “restaurant” or “restaraunt”? Let’s dive into the intricacies of this word and determine the correct spelling once and for all.
The correct spelling of this word, my dear readers, is “restaurant.” Yes, you heard it right! It’s spelled with an “au,” not an “ar.” This may come as a surprise to some of you who have been using the incorrect spelling for years.
